When you’re choosing the right tires for your ride, you might see numbers like 225/60R17 or 275/40R20 on the sidewall. But what do those numbers really mean? The first two digits (225 or 275) represent the tire’s width in millimeters. Now, here’s where things get interesting โ the next number (60 or 40) is the aspect ratio, which is the ratio of the tire’s height to its width.
For example, if you have a tire with a 60 aspect ratio, that means the tire’s height is 60% of its width. This affects how the tire handles, its rolling resistance, and even its fuel efficiency. So, if you’re looking to upgrade your tires, it’s essential to consider the aspect ratio, not just the width.

Let’s compare two different tire sizes: 205/50R16 and 225/45R17. The first set of numbers (205 and 50) represent the tire’s width (205 mm) and aspect ratio (50%), while the second set (225 and 45) represents a wider tire (225 mm) with a lower aspect ratio (45%). The R16 and R17 represent the wheel diameter (16 and 17 inches, respectively).
So, why is this important? Choosing the right tire size can affect your car’s performance, fuel efficiency, and even safety. A tire that’s too small can lead to reduced traction and increased wear, while a tire that’s too large can compromise your car’s handling and stability.
